Загрузка...

Best Practices for DataFrame Performance #ai #artificialintelligence #machinelearning #aiagent #Best

@genaiexp Achieving optimal performance with Spark DataFrames requires a combination of strategic data handling and configuration tuning. Begin by creating DataFrames efficiently, ensuring that you use the appropriate data types for your columns. This can significantly reduce storage and computation overhead. Avoid wide transformations, which can lead to excessive data shuffling, and instead, use narrow transformations like 'map' and 'filter' where possible. When dealing with small datasets, consider using broadcast joins to avoid shuffles. Broadcasting a small DataFrame to the executors can minimize data transfer, speeding up join operations. Additionally, tuning Spark configurations, such as executor memory and the number of partitions, based on the workload can lead to better resource utilization and performance. By following these best practices, you can harness the full power of Spark for your data processing tasks.

Видео Best Practices for DataFrame Performance #ai #artificialintelligence #machinelearning #aiagent #Best канала NextGen AI Explorer
Яндекс.Метрика

На информационно-развлекательном портале SALDA.WS применяются cookie-файлы. Нажимая кнопку Принять, вы подтверждаете свое согласие на их использование.

Об использовании CookiesПринять